The specific South Korean customs rules I followed
I must emphasize the importance of the 200 USD de minimis threshold for shipments originating from the US to South Korea. Because the Anker MagGo 3-in-1 Charging Station is well below this limit, I did not have to pay additional import duties or VAT upon arrival in Incheon. I ensured my Personal Customs Clearance Code (PCCC) was correctly attached to my South Korea delivery profile to prevent any delays at the border.
How I used a proxy service for a seamless purchase
I encountered a situation where my Korean credit card was declined by a specific US electronics retailer. Instead of giving up, I opted for the BuyForMe service. This assisted purchase option allowed the forwarder to buy the item on my behalf using a US-based payment method. I found this to be a critical backup plan when dealing with strict US merchant payment gateways. This ensured I did not miss out on the limited-time 2026 launch pricing.
